Common questions and challenges
People dealing with false sex crime accusations in Indiana often face similar concerns:
How much evidence does the state need?
Sex crime cases sometimes rely on statements rather than physical proof. This can create confusion about what the state considers “enough.” Evidence does not have to be perfect, but it must meet legal standards. The firm explains what those standards mean in plain language.
Can a case move forward even if the accusation is false?
Yes. The state can continue even if the original statement changes. This is why early guidance and a careful review of evidence matter.
What if the accusation came from a misunderstanding?
Misunderstandings happen often. A disagreement, unclear communication, or mixed signals can lead to mistaken conclusions. These situations still require a solid defense plan.
How long does a case usually take?
Sex crime cases in Indianapolis vary. Some resolve quickly. Others take months. Hearings, motions, and the court's calendar influence the timeline. You will receive updates at each stage.

FAQs about false sex crime accusations in Indiana
What should I do first if someone makes a false accusation against me?
Stay calm and avoid contact with the person who made the claim. Reach out to an attorney familiar with false sex crime accusations in Indiana so you understand what steps to take next.
Will I have to speak to the police right away?
You can choose to speak or not speak. Many people decide to talk with an attorney before answering questions about false sex crime accusations in Indiana. This protects your rights.
Can digital messages help my case?
Yes. Texts, emails, and social media posts can help clear up misunderstandings. Your attorney will review them as part of the defense against false sex crime accusations in Indiana.
Do these cases usually go to trial?
Some do, but many resolve before trial. It depends on the strength of the accusation, available evidence, and how prosecutors view the case.
